You aren't doing awful! It's not a race and where you are in the weight loss also plays a role.
In the beginning, weight comes off easier. First there is the water weight thing and also there is the big loser high. It's easy to stick with a program.
As the months tick by, it gets harder to stick to eating less than you are burning AND, the body adapts, so weight loss slows down. And, of course, the lighter you are, the lower your BMR (takes less energy to sustain your weight) so you can create less and less of a deficit.
So, in the beginning months, I expect 10 pounds a month (as I'm nearly 100 pounds overweight). Probably starting next month I will shoot for 8 pounds, and then as I get closer to goal, 5 pounds. Heck, towards goal 3 pounds is a good month!
ETA: and big losses are from big changes (and still usually just the start of weight loss only). There is no need to make HUGE changes either. Everything is about making changes that are sustainable.
